Study Summary
This study is being conducted to compare the immunogenicity, safety, and viral shedding of a new A/H1N1 strain that will be incorporated into the FluMist quadrivalent formulation for the 2017-2018 influenza season with the previous A/H1N1 strain that was included in the vaccine in the 2015-2016 influenza season.
Interventions
- BIOLOGICAL FluMist trivalent (2015-2016)
- BIOLOGICAL FluMist Quadrivalent (2015-2016)
- BIOLOGICAL FluMist Quadrivalent (2017-2018)
